抗肺炎球菌血清的特异性蛋白质的特性:I. 关于沉淀素含量的 I 型血清的小鼠保护价值。

PROPERTIES OF THE TYPE SPECIFIC PROTEINS OF ANTIPNEUMOCOCCUS SERA : I. THE MOUSE PROTECTIVE VALUE OF TYPE I SERA WITH REFERENCE TO THE PRECIPITIN CONTENT.

Abstract

The ability to carry out with some measure of precision mouse protection tests for the estimation of potency of antipneumococcus sera has made possible the correlation of the protective potency with the amount of specifically precipitable protein. With antipneumococcus rabbit sera these protective ratios are relatively constant and higher than those with immune horse serum. Type I antipneumococcus horse sera, on the other hand, show no such constancy but fall into two groups; and there is as yet no simple method for determining to which group a serum belongs.

摘要

进行一定精度的抗肺炎球菌血清效价估计的小鼠保护试验的能力,使得将保护效力与特异性沉淀蛋白的量相关联成为可能。用抗肺炎球菌兔血清,这些保护比相对恒定且高于用免疫马血清。另一方面,I 型抗肺炎球菌马血清则没有这种恒定性,而是分为两组;而且目前还没有一种简单的方法来确定一个血清属于哪一组。
